Output 645c7184e048bd5fbe2f3308fb95d15d6cfa3bff3ff774f023c72ea36f215051:1

value
2954996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b511826eaa8fc7d1cc25638df89325c24a7804a OP_EQUAL
address
3QbrgE7okhRDNz5JnYE2nXriVEJCYxZRJw
transaction
645c7184e048bd5fbe2f3308fb95d15d6cfa3bff3ff774f023c72ea36f215051
spent
true